new: center of gravity

This commit is contained in:
Benoît Sierro
2023-08-28 11:40:26 +02:00
parent b89a76db16
commit c3d1d7f970

View File

@@ -125,8 +125,7 @@ class Spectrum(np.ndarray):
@property
def center_of_gravity(self):
intensity = self.time_int
return np.sum(intensity * self.t) / np.sum(intensity)
return pulse.center_of_gravity(self.t, self.time_int)
def mask_wl(self, pos: float, width: float) -> Spectrum:
"""